# Quillbase Environments: Connection Pooling

Quillbase runs three environments: dev, staging, prod. Each has its own pgbouncer tier fronting the profile database. Pool exhaustion pages route to on-call; check saturation dashboards first, then idle connection counts. Do not raise pool sizes in prod without a capacity review — staging limits differ intentionally. Current per-environment pool configuration values follow below.

service settings:
PRAIX_LOG_LEVEL=error
PRAIX_METRICS_HOST=metrics.praix.qorvelcorp.corp
PRAIX_POOL_SIZE=16

## Tuning the fan-out

Galefinch pushes weather alerts to every registered plugin sink, and the fan-out can get spicy during storm season. If your plugin is slow to ack, you'll get batched rather than dropped — but batching too hard adds latency nobody wants. Tweak carefully and test against the staging feed. The defaults we ship are listed below.

constants for tageg-kagag:
QUOTAS = {
    "kelax": 495,
    "istath": 366,
    "tammir": 108,
    "novdor": 730,
    "casax": 816,
    "quenael": 874,
    "pelius": 403,
}

**Ticket: Billing worker blue-green cutover failing in staging**

During Tuesday's blue-green deploy of the Farrowbill billing worker, the green stack came up without its queue credential, so it silently processed zero invoices while health checks passed. Proposed fix: make the readiness probe verify queue auth. The missing entry belongs on the next line of the green env file.

vault entry, bagep-yahip: VAULT_KEY8=d2a227e5

Runbook: Quartzel query planner regression. Symptom: SELECTs on the ledger tables jump from ~40ms to 3s+ after stats refresh. Cause: planner picks nested-loop join when row estimates skew low. Mitigation: disable adaptive join selection and re-analyze the affected tables; do not bump work memory first, it masks the issue. Verify plans with EXPLAIN before closing the incident. Apply the mitigation by restarting the planner service with these settings.

config for bahif-yahag:
[druath]
port = 5432
region = central-4
host = druath.tolvaqsys.corp
timeout_ms = 500
retries = 6